What are your thoughts on the value of Data Governance to an organisation?

As an AI language model, I can tell you that Data Governance is an essential practice for any organization that wants to effectively manage its data assets. Data governance is the process of managing the availability, usability, and integrity of the data used by an organization.

Here are some of the ways in which data governance can add value to an organization:

Improved Data Quality: With proper data governance, an organization can ensure that its data is accurate, complete, and consistent. This, in turn, can help to improve the quality of decision-making and enable the organization to achieve its goals more effectively.

Compliance: Data governance can help an organization to comply with data-related regulations and laws such as the GDPR or HIPAA. By establishing policies and procedures for data collection, usage, and retention, an organization can avoid legal and financial penalties associated with non-compliance.

Cost Reduction: Proper data governance can help to reduce the costs associated with managing data by eliminating duplicate or unnecessary data, ensuring that data is stored in the most appropriate and cost-effective way, and optimizing data management processes.

Overall, data governance is a critical practice that can help organizations to effectively manage their data assets, improve decision-making, comply with regulations, and reduce costs.

Is Data Governance important for AI?

Yes, data governance is extremely important for AI. This is because AI algorithms rely heavily on data to learn and make predictions. If the data used to train an AI model is inaccurate, incomplete, biased, or inconsistent, the model's predictions and recommendations can be unreliable or even harmful.

Proper data governance is therefore essential to ensure that the data used to train AI models is of high quality, accurate, and representative of the real world. This involves establishing policies and procedures for data collection, storage, and usage.

Additionally, data governance can help to address the issue of algorithmic bias in AI. Bias can be introduced into an AI model if the data used to train it is biased or if the model's algorithms are designed with inherent biases. Data governance can help to mitigate these issues by ensuring that data is diverse, representative, and unbiased, and by establishing ethical guidelines for AI development and deployment.

In summary, data governance is critical for AI as it ensures the quality and reliability of the data used to train AI models, reduces the risk of algorithmic bias, and promotes ethical AI development and deployment.
